In every story task you get one sentence which has to be the first sentence of your story and the text has to be related to this. Use past continuous to set the scene and to describe actions or situations that were in progress (not finished) at a certain point in the story. Write how your character looked, what qualities did it/ he/ she posses— you can do it using conversations or dialogues.
